Water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small, contained water damage.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Water damage can spread quickly and cause costly damage, call a pro to ensure your safety and property.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| Maybe | Yes | DIY might be okay for small areas, but a pro will ensure the job is done right and safely. |
| Hidden water damage behind walls | No | Yes | Water damage can be hidden and costly to fix, call a pro to ensure you catch it before it’s too late. |
| Mold growth in attic or crawl space | No | Yes | Mold can be toxic and cause serious health problems, call a pro for safe and effective mold remediation. |
| Water damage to structural elements (e.g. Floor joists) | No | Yes | Water damage to structural elements can be costly and difficult to fix, call a pro to ensure the job is done right. |

Water Damage Restoration Cost in the 75067 Area
The cost of water dam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in the 75067 area. We’ll provide you with a free estimate after an on-site assessment, contact us today to schedule your appointment.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and amount of water present. |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and complexity of drying process. |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and level of moisture detected. |
| Sewage Cleanup |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and level of contamination. |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and complexity of recovery process. |
| Mold Rem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and level of mold growth. |
